The pad comes packaged in a pretty good-sized box. Included are six big foam puzzle pieces, the pad itself, a USB and sound adapter, and instructions. To “construct” the pad all you have to do is build the big foam puzzle using the labeled pieces. Each piece is marked 1 through 6 and the instructions feature a diagram of where each number goes.
